Description of Service and Consent. If enabled by Platform for your Account, Mobile check deposit ("Mobile Deposit") allows you to make deposits to your Account remotely by using the Mobile App to take a legible picture of the front and back of the negotiable check(s) and transmitting images of such instruments to Bank in compliance with Bank’s requirements ("Check Image(s)"). If the Check Image is accepted for deposit, Platform will notify you electronically through the communication method(s) you have elected as preference ("Electronic Notice"). The Bank will then attempt to collect the item by presenting the image or converting the image into a digital representation of the original check ("Substitute Check"). Unlike traditional check deposits, you retain the original paper check when you use Mobile Deposit. See Section 7.0 “Substitute Check Policy Disclosure” below for further information on Substitute Checks and Section 6.9 "Retention of Original Check" below for retention requirements. The manner in which Substitute Checks are cleared, presented for payment and deposited will be determined by the Bank, in Bank’s sole discretion. Platform, acting as an agent of the Bank, may change, modify, add or remove functionality from Mobile Deposit at any time, with or without notice to you.
